Jesse Puljujarvi may soon be on his way to the Sunshine State.
The former Pittsburgh Penguins forward, who cleared waivers on Sunday, has signed a PTO (professional tryout) with the Charlotte Checkers of the AHL, the Florida Panthers‘ AHL affiliate, the team announced Monday.
Puljujarvi had his contract terminated on Sunday after clearing waivers.
The 26-year-old has struggled to produce since joining the Penguins in the 2023-24 season and has bounced between the AHL and NHL levels for the past two years.
In 26 games at the NHL level this season, the Finnish national has three goals and six assists. He has one goal and two assists in four games with the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ins, Pittsburgh’s AHL affiliate.
He originally signed with the Penguins in December 2023 and has appeared in 48 contests, picking up just 17 points.
He then re-signed on a two-year deal valued at $1.6 million with the Penguins in February 2024.
The fourth-overall pick by the Edmonton Oilers from the 2016 draft has scored 57 goals and collected 127 points over 382 career NHL games.
